The Overview

From proof-of-concept to production-grade platform

Project Stark is a joint BT and IBM initiative to embed AI agents throughout the Business Analyst SDLC — from initial idea capture through to engineering-ready user stories and acceptance criteria in JIRA. The programme began as a PoC built on IBM's internal tooling platform, delivered on BT's AWS infrastructure.

The Challenge

A long, manual, multi-stage process — with compounding friction at every step

Discovery workshops with BT BAs, PMs and the IBM delivery team surfaced a consistent set of pain points across the full idea-to-JIRA workflow.

“Before the process moves — sometimes shaping documents do not include this detail, that it is very important.”

— Senior Business Analyst, BT

Quality

Drafts not “engineering ready,” creating slow, repeated back-and-forth between BAs and Solution Architects.

Inconsistent Output

Shaping documents vary widely in completeness, tone, and complexity, making consistent AI support difficult.

Idle Time

Work frequently stalls in review queues, with no proactive nudge to unblock it.

Time-Consuming Groundwork

Manual AWS process mapping, competitor research, and BA drafting consume disproportionate BA time.

Fragmented Context

Business rules, legal/regulatory constraints (Ofcom, data-sensitive setting) and prior context are scattered rather than centrally available.

Discovery Approach

Design Thinking Workshops — Double Diamond

The team ran a structured series of Design Thinking Workshops (Parts 1–4) following a Double Diamond approach — Discover, Define, Develop, Deliver.

01

As-Is Process Mapping

Mapped the existing BA workflow end to end — idea intake via JIRA, story creation and SA review. Persona, time taken, tools, pain points, and candidate Key Agent Value Areas.

02

Context & Gold-Standard Documents

Defined what “good” looks like for AI inputs and outputs; gold-standard requirement documents, user stories and acceptance criteria scored across quality, topic, and complexity.

03

Value Hypotheses & Prioritisation

Brainstormed and voted on candidate use cases — from AI-checked coverage of story generation to INVEST-aligned drafting, staffing, and QA notification agents.

Solution Design

The AI-Powered SDLC Application

Built around three core views: a personalised dashboard, a human-in-the-loop story review page, and an embedded conversational AI assistant.

View 01

Personalised Work List Dashboard

Each BA gets an immediate view of their queue — stories created, pending reviews, and open flagged issues — alongside a prioritised list surfaced from JIRA tickets.

  • Low-friction triage via Quick-Preview links
  • Priority flags (High/Medium) keep urgent work visible
  • Dedicated SME override-panel for auditable governance

View 02

User Story Review & Feedback Page

The core human-in-the-loop screen. Each AI-generated story is shown with description, acceptance criteria, and a structured quality evaluation reflecting INVEST compliance.

  • Star-rated quality scoring tied to INVEST compliance
  • Given-When-Then acceptance criteria structure
  • Full audit trail from first draft to approved output

Evaluation Framework

Keeping AI trustworthy — a multi-stage approach

Recognising that AI quality is the biggest adoption risk, the team designed a staged evaluation flow rather than a single pass/fail gate.

Stage 1 · Input evaluation
Guardrail checks (right cluster, right document type) before generation begins.
Agent
Stage 2 · Automated evaluation
Common eval (business intent alignment, traceability, clarity, domain correctness) plus task-specific INVEST criteria.
LLM-as-judge
Stage 3 · End-of-generation review
Qualitative + quantitative feedback scored against a 0–100% threshold; output routed for re-run if below target.
LLM-as-judge
Stage 4 · Human-in-the-loop review
BT and/or IBM human review of high-stakes or low-confidence output before publish.
BA / SME

Test the Limits

Ran the agent close to real-world shaping documents, not just clean demos.

Balanced Judgement

Neither too tough nor too lenient — checked out LLM-as-judge scoring being too generous.

Full Auditability

Score every intermediate step, for auditability and trend-based improvement over releases.
